Due Diligence Spyi distribution growth

26 Upvotes

I like to take multiple perspectives on investing covered call funds as an income vehicle and in comparison to traditional dividend investing.

One of the primary talking points from dividend investor purists is that there is no dividend growth. These are the folks that hold schd for example, where year over years growth of dividends can easily be double digits. For spyi, I would argue there can be dividend growth. Dividends can shrink also. If the s&p does well, spyi appreciates, and the distribution appreciates with it. So if one believes the overall direction of the market is up, long term distribution growth is inevitable. It won't be double digit growth, but in the short history we have, distribution per share has increased.

I think what purists fear is volatility. There is a case to be made where you could take a huge haircut on payouts. I'm thinking 20-30% or more, lasting for multiple payout cycles. During these periods, schd has maintained payments pretty well, as a function of the stocks/index it tracks. So if you're relying on every penny, every cycle, these events dropping spyi distribution would cause chaos.

I welcome any counter arguments, recognizing what sub I'm in here.

Seeking Advice How is this setup for current income + growth for retirement?

12 Upvotes
Investments Asset base $ distribution  Yield     Contribution 
 Brokerage  300,000 30,000 10%  CC ETFs  $5K/year
 Brokerage  750,000 30,000 4.0%  Div & Bond ETFs  $2.5K/year
Retirement 2,000,000 30,000 1.50% $49K/year
Total 3,050,000 90,000      
Sell shares   50,000 2.5% Of Total  
Grand Total To spend 140,000      

I apologize, here are the details. All aspirational. Current income is about $150K a year. Wanting to replace spouse's income ($60K) on the brokerage distributions as spouse retires early (in about 5 years), will sell our house to fund the brokerage and downsize to a more manageable empty nesting place in fairly HCOL big city in TX or make a move to a HCOL area in CA to rent a place for similar cost to owning our current place in TX.. (I know big unknowns!). I would retire in about 10 years. Both in mid 40's now.

Current $60K CC ETF portfolio: SVOL 16%, XQQI 13%, MLPI 9%, IWMI 10%, ILS 6%, HYBI 5%, HIGH 5%, NIHI 5%, PFFD 5%, IAUI 5%, BIZD 5%, JAAA 4%, TLTI 3%, XBCI 3%, IYRI 2%. Total estimated yield today 14%, total monthly cash distribution today approx. $7K/year. This would be increased to $300K aspirationally.

Dividend growth ETF & Bond Yield portfolio would be: , 20% schd, 10% SPYD, 10% DVY, 10% DIV, 20%VCSH, 15% USHY, 15% schi. Total est yield today is 4.5% or so. This is aspirational with the $750K future value.

Retirement account would be $2M (401K and IRA's) in 10 years would be 30% QQQ, 30% VTI, and 40% VEU. Gives about 1.5% yield and would sell shares of 2.5% to cover the rest. Yield $30K, selling of shares $50K.

Gives total of 30+30+30+50= $140K to cover all living expenses at full retirement in 10 years. Technically would only be selling 2.5% of total growth portfolio ($2M), considering retirement time horizon of 30-40 years. How does this look?
